Which of the following equations is equivalent to 8(k + 11) - 6k = 19?

A. 2k + 11 = 19
B. 14k + 88 = 19
C. 14k + 11 = 19
D. 2k + 88 = 19​

Answer:

D. 2k+88=19

Explanation:

distribute the 8 to the k and 11, and you should get 8k +11 by multiplying the 8 to the k and 8 to the 11. now you have 8k+88-6k=19, and now you should combine like terms. 8k-6k=2k. so the answer is 2k+88=19
